I didn't know that BBC 5Live Sports Extra were carrying games live.

I'm currently listening the Yankees trying to save their season, and doing pretty well.

Not only are the games live on the radio, announced by US commentators, but the inter inning links are hosted by Jonny Gould and Josh Chetwynd.

Bloomin' marvellous news for us "baseball nuts"
